Output 245da63334b66309251f1d213c0d0697935aeefe8f5691db82568e8b03dafa18:1

value
903706
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91aa9bd86a6975386b14cd1ff75fc820a6dcfaf8 OP_EQUALVERIFY OP_CHECKSIG
address
1EHDMvQ25ad6otjm27ZNtCpGF2ccQnxYc8
transaction
245da63334b66309251f1d213c0d0697935aeefe8f5691db82568e8b03dafa18
spent
true